Catalan leader Quim Torra demands independence referendum days before street protests

CATALAN President Quim Torra has renewed calls for the Spanish government to accept a referendum on independence.
The move comes two days before separatist protesters take to the streets in the first of several major demonstrations.
Recent months have seen an easing of tensions between the secessionist Catalan government and Madrid, but Torra has also repeated demands for charges to be dropped against nine separatist leaders.
The leaders are accused of various crimes including the serious charge of rebellion for their role in last year’s banned referendum.
The trial could begin as early as October, putting further pressure on Prime Minister Pedro Sanchez as he seeks a resolution to the crisis.
Hundreds of thousands of Catalan independence supporters are expected to march in Barcelona on September 11.
